开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

我们这边碰到一个Dataworks的调度问题,设置的任务是分钟级别,这种问题有办法解决吗?

我们这边碰到一个Dataworks的调度问题,设置的任务是分钟级别(30分钟),但是实例是1小时调度一次,关于上游依赖是日调度。这种问题有办法解决吗?或者具体原因知道吗?

展开
收起
真的很搞笑 2024-01-27 17:17:57 38 0
2 条回答
写回答
取消 提交回答
  • "看下 9:30 开始 间隔半小时 确实每小时只有一个实例image.png
    ,此回答整理自钉群“DataWorks交流群(答疑@机器人)”"

    2024-01-28 09:29:34
    赞同 展开评论 打赏
  • 面对过去,不要迷离;面对未来,不必彷徨;活在今天,你只要把自己完全展示给别人看。

    您遇到的问题可能是由于DataWorks调度系统中,不同调度周期的任务实例挂载依赖的方式导致的。以下是一些可能的原因和解决方法:

    1. 调度类型不匹配:如果上游任务是日调度,而下游任务设置为分钟级别调度,这可能会导致下游任务无法按照预期的30分钟间隔执行。
    2. 默认挂载规则:DataWorks在处理上下游不同调度周期的任务时,有一套默认的挂载依赖规则。您可能需要根据这些规则来调整任务的调度配置。
    3. 调度时间间隔设置:确保您的分钟调度任务的时间间隔设置正确。DataWorks的分钟调度最小粒度是5分钟,所以如果您设置的是每30分钟运行一次,实际的调度间隔应该是30分钟的倍数。
    4. 调度时间段:检查小时调度任务的时间段设置是否正确。例如,如果您希望任务在每天的00:00到03:00之间每小时运行一次,需要确保这个时间段内每个整点都有任务实例运行。
    5. 调度实例生成:对于日、周、月等大于天的调度周期,DataWorks会在每天生成相应的调度实例。如果在某个不运行的日子,实际上会按照空跑处理,这可能会影响依赖这些实例的下游任务。

    综上所述,为了解决这个问题,您可以尝试以下步骤:

    1. 确认上游任务的调度周期和下游任务的调度周期是否匹配。
    2. 检查DataWorks的挂载依赖规则,并根据业务需求调整任务的调度配置。
    3. 确保分钟调度和小时调度的时间间隔和时间段设置正确无误。
    4. 如果问题依然存在,建议查阅DataWorks的官方文档或联系技术支持以获得更具体的帮助。
    2024-01-27 20:51:06
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

相关产品

  • 大数据开发治理平台 DataWorks
  • 热门讨论

    热门文章

    相关电子书

    更多
    DataWorks数据集成实时同步最佳实践(含内测邀请)-2020飞天大数据平台实战应用第一季 立即下载
    DataWorks调度任务迁移最佳实践-2020飞天大数据平台实战应用第一季 立即下载
    DataWorks商业化资源组省钱秘籍-2020飞天大数据平台实战应用第一季 立即下载

    相关实验场景

    更多